hydrolic system

question: I had my hydrolic line fix and was ready to go tomorrow. We went to fill our 350 Georgetown 2012 with gas and found the line leaking again.I tighten the line and put hydrolic fluid in the motorhome. We went and started the motorhome up to look for a leak and seen none, but when we look at the lippert controls all the lights on the left side are blinking. Do not know why!! The on button will not come on nothing but all the lights on the left side blink. Does anyone know if there is a reset for the system ? Has anyone had this problem, really want to go tomorrow on our first trip. Thanks for your help in advance.

Just this morning caught your note. All four LEDs left mean "latched out", due Low voltage or excess time on pump. Reset pushing all four direction buttons at the same time. Front, right etc. Hopefully you're already under way.
